    dOPC Clone is more than a normal OPC server simulator. With dOPC Clone you can now create copies of other OPC DA servers, which allows you to emulate any OPC server with no need for an underlying communications network. dOPC Clone allows full emulation of other OPC DA servers! This will vastly improve your OPC system development, configuration, and demonstration. dOPC Clone server emulator overview: Designed for: Windows Vista, XP, 2000, NT, 98, Me; OPC compliance tested; OPC portable software, e.g. executable from a USB drive; Very small, less than 1 MB; Supports OPC DA 1, 2, and 3 compliance servers; Smart and simple user interface; The building of own royalty-free simulation servers; dOPC Clone solves the common problem of not always being able to connect to a "real" OPC server to work with. The smart and simple user interface allows you to create an exact copy of the "real" OPC server, in less than five minutes, which contains the same items and data as the original OPC DA server, but which works without any underlying communication network. With dOPC Clone it is now much easier to create, develop, test, configure or demonstrate your OPC HMI/SCADA visualization or other OPC client applications.

    Han-soft - Net Time Server & Client (Full License) - Synchronize your PC's system clock or all PC's system clock in your LAN on TCP/IP networks. The NetTime Server & Client application allows you to synchronize your PC's system clock or all PC's system clock in your LAN using various time server types commonly available on TCP/IP networks, such as the Internet or LAN, And multiple time protocols are supported. As Client, the protocol currently supported are Time protocols(RFC868), and Simple Network Time protocols(SNTP-RFC2030). It can be configured to full-Time protocols(RFC868) or SNTP protocols(RFC2030) compliance, including client support of broadcast, and multicast modes. As Server, NetTime Server & Client will itself provide time services to other computers using Simple Network Time protocols(SNTP-RFC2030) or Time Protocols(RFC868). It can be configured to full-Time protocols(RFC868) or SNTP protocols(RFC2030) compliance, including server support of unicast and multicast modes. You can synchronize your Windows, Unix, Linux, FreeBSD, etc. system clocks via SNTP protocol, too. NetTime Server & Client normally runs as a standard 32-bit Windows 98, Windows Me, Windows NT, Windows 2000, Windows XP or Windows 2003 application. In Windows NT/2000/XP/2003 system, the NetTime Server & Client can work as a service. Features 1.
